Matariki marks a special time for reflection, connection, and new beginnings in Aotearoa. Across Christchurch, it has become an important cultural and community celebration, offering families a chance to slow down, appreciate what they have, and plan for the year ahead.

During the winter school holidays, local attractions and events provide plenty of options for family fun. Tūranga Library hosts Matariki storytelling sessions and interactive workshops for kids, while the Christchurch Art Gallery often features family-friendly exhibitions. Local marae and community centres welcome families to participate in traditional celebrations, kai sharing, and cultural learning experiences.

For outdoor enthusiasts, winter doesn’t mean staying indoors. The Christchurch Coastal Pathway, Bottle Lake Forest, and Travis Wetland offer opportunities for cycling, walking, and birdwatching, while Hanmer Springs and the Port Hills provide weekend escapes for more adventurous families. Even a simple backyard adventure camping, craft projects, or baking together can create lasting holiday memories.
